Summary:
While it recognized that the Commission had a discretion in the matter (extension of the time to appeal), the FCA drew the Commission's attention to factors such as the seriousness of a determination that false or misleading statements had been made, the amount of penalty imposed and the fact that there was a delay of only one month after the time limit for the appeal. The FCA viewed all these as "special reasons" to be taken into account by the Commission in exercising its discretion.

Summary:
The delay, it is suggested, is not substantial. Certainly, the length of the delay is an important factor to be considered, but it would be quite inappropriate for me to accept it as the sole factor to be examined. Indeed, it is only one of several factors. The most important is the reason given.
